Vibration Welding machine

Vibration Welding is a joining solution used for welding various components, especially those that are complex, irregularly shaped, or large. This method harnesses the power of heat energy, which is generated by inducing a linear, back-and-forth motion in one part while keeping the other part stationary. As the movement generates heat, it initiates a controlled melting process at the interface of the parts. For successful vibration welding, the design of the parts should accommodate the relative motion involved in the process.

Vibration welding machine technology uses fast back-and-forth motion to generate heat and friction at the joint between the parts being joined. This continues until the plastic reaches a molten state. Once the plastic is molten, it solidifies under pressure, creating a strong, permanent bond. Vibration welding offers several advantages as a joining method:

  • Fast weld times: around 20 seconds from one part to another.
  • Power efficiency: It is considered a green machine as it is energy-efficient, making it a sustainable choice for manufacturing processes.
  • Reusable resource: Vibration welders have a long lifespan, often lasting between 12 to 16 years, making them a durable and reusable resource.
  • Quick change tooling: enables the use of multiple parts by facilitating easy and efficient tooling changes, increasing productivity and flexibility.
  • No marking of show surfaces: Vibration welding ensures that no visible marks or blemishes are left on the surfaces of the assembled parts, maintaining their aesthetic appeal.
  • Accurate part-to-part dimensional: The precision of vibration welding results in consistent and accurate dimensions between the joined parts, ensuring a reliable fit.
  • Strong welds: Vibration welding creates strong, reliable welds, producing durable connections between the parts.
  • Hermetic seals: This method can achieve hermetic seals, ensuring an airtight or watertight joint when required, providing excellent sealing properties.

Application Considerations

  • Medical applications include surgical instruments, filters and I-V units, bedpans and insulated trays.
  • Jfortune vibration welders find extensive utility across various industries and applications. Here are some examples:
  • Automotive assembly: Jfortune vibration welders are well-suited for joining components in automotive applications such as door panels, intake manifolds, instrument panels, tail lights, lenses, fluid reservoirs, and bumpers.
  • Aviation applications: like assembling HVAC ducts, air diverter valves, interior lighting, and overhead storage bins.
  • Appliance manufacturing: like dishwasher pumps and spray arms, detergent dispensers, and vacuum cleaner housings.
  • Accessories applications: like business and consumer toner cartridges, point-of-purchase displays, display stands, and shelves.
  • Chainsaw housings and power tools: Vibration welders are utilized in the assembly of chainsaw housings and power tools.
  • Medical applications: These welders find applications in the medical field for joining surgical instruments, filters, I-V units, bedpans, and insulated trays.
